About Promotions and Deals


A promotion is a special discount that you create to market a specific product. For example, if you want to increase the sales of a specific model of computer, you might offer a promotional discount of 10% on that model for one month.

After you create an account promotion, customers from those accounts can view the promotional deal in catalog views, while the promotion is available. When the promotion period expires or when the fund that was created to pay for the promotion becomes inactive, the promotion is no longer visible to customers.

NOTE:  You cannot create promotions for customizable products.

NOTE:  If you use promotions and deals with other types of price adjustments, the final price depends on the order in which Siebel ePricer applies the pricing adjustments. For more information, see The Processing Order of Price Adjustments.
